KOTA KINABALU: Sarawak Energy Berhad and Sabah Electricity Sdn Bhd have been hailed as two key utility champions capable of driving the long-aspired ASEAN Power Grid.

ASEAN Centre for Energy (ACE) executive director Datuk Abdul Razib Dawood said this came following the successful implementation of the Sarawak–Sabah power interconnection.

He said the interconnection represents an important milestone not only for both states, but also for the broader ASEAN energy landscape, describing it as a crucial sub-regional step towards realising the Borneo Grid and, eventually, a fully integrated ASEAN Power Grid linking all 11 ASEAN member states.

Abdul Razib said the project clearly demonstrated that power system integration strengthens participating grids, even without perfect conditions.

“You do not have to wait for a perfect system. Sarawak helping Sabah strengthens Sabah, and at the same time Sabah continues to strengthen its own internal grid. These two efforts go hand in hand and reinforce each other,” he said.
